Swindon pub The Glue Pot is celebrating it’s 10th consecutive entry in the CAMRA Good Beer Guide, out today for its 45th Edition.
Landlord JC (Jonathan Crisp) says “I’m overjoyed that the hard work of my wonderful team to consistently serve the very best pint of Ale and Traditional Cider has been recognised yet again, the entries in the Guide are selected by CAMRA Members, who are essentially the drinking public, and that means that the inclusion is a trusted recommendation, for many people the guide is the first place to look for a decent pint when visiting a new town. For us remaining in the GBG each year is more important the getting in it in the first place, if we were to drop out it would be a disaster for us! My Team and I are rightfully proud of the 8 Real Ales and at least 8 Traditional Ciders we offer each and every day!”
The Glue Pot is also the current CAMRA Swindon & N.Wiltshire Cider Pub of the Year.
